STT Woman Charged with Assault/Domestic Violence

The V.I. Police Domestic Violence Unit on Friday arrested 45-year-old Sherrolyn Warner of Frydenhoj and charged her with assaulting a teenager, the police reported Sunday.

According to the VIPD, at 3 p.m. Thursday the Domestic Violence Unit was requested to travel to the Ivanna Eudora Kean High School about a female minor who said she had been assaulted by an adult female acquaintance.

Investigations revealed that the female minor had noticeable bruises about her arms and legs. Further Investigation revealed that these injuries were sustained from being beaten with a belt and the flat side of a machete.

The minor female was taken into protective custody by a social worker from Human Services.

At about 1:35 p.m., Warner was present at the Criminal Investigation Bureau, was placed under arrest, and charged with third-degree assault/domestic violence. She was booked, processed, and turned over to the Bureau of Corrections pending her advice of rights hearing. No bail was set in pursuance of the domestic violence law.
